10. STABILITYAND REACTIVITY
NORMALLY STABLE? (CONDITIONS TOAVOID):
The product is stable.
Do not mix with oxygen or air above atmospheric pressure. Any source of high temperature, such as lighted cigarettes, flames, hot spots or welding may yield toxic and/or corrosive decomposition products.
INCOMPATIBILITIES:
(Under specific conditions: e.g. very high temperatures and/or appropriate pressures) - Freshly abraded
aluminum surfaces (may cause strong exothermic reaction). Chemically active metals: potassium, calcium, powdered aluminum, magnesium and zinc.
HAZARDOUS DECOMPOSITION PRODUCTS:
Halogens, halogen acids and possible carbonyl halides.
HAZARDOUS POLYMERIZATION:
Will not occur.
